Review: Tom's of Maine Natural Deodorant

I like to smell nice, who doesn't? However, I've been concerned for some time about the ingredients in regular antiperspirant/deodorant. Just the way that antiperspirant makes my underarms feel let's me know that it's not "right". So in my quest for an all-natural alternative, I came across Tom's of Maine. I already really liked their toothpaste, so I decided to give it a try.

Now of course it's simply a deodorant and not an antiperspirant, but really, unless you have an actual medical condition that causes excess sweating - normal sweating is, well, normal. So I wasn't concerned about that.

Unfortunately -- no matter how much of that stuff I slathered on my poor little underarms, by the end of the day, I smelled like I had just returned from a long day of playing softball, or construction, or really anything that makes you smell REALLY BAD.

So I'm giving Tom's a big thumbs down....

And just so I don't end this post on a real downer -- I'll let you know what I found that did work. Salt crystal deodorant (Google it). Doesn't even seem to matter what brand. Cool eh?
